Advertisement
packyy

nicobrowser_cef_sound_toggle

Mar 6th, 2018
99
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C# 2.26 KB | None | 0 0
  1. private void sound_toggle()
  2.         {
  3.            
  4.            
  5.            // if (txtgettitle.Text.Contains("nico"))
  6.             //{
  7.                 string script = string.Format("document.getElementsByClassName('___button___P4VSB ___button-base___2v_kF ___button-skin___39Jyb ___local-tooltip___12dLk')[0].click();");
  8.                 browser.EvaluateScriptAsync(script);
  9.                 Console.WriteLine("音量ON/OFF変更を試みました");
  10.             // }
  11.             if (txtgettitle.Text.Contains("on")){
  12.               //  adjFontloc_noteon();
  13.             }
  14.            /* else{
  15.                 //adjFontloc_noteoff();
  16.             }*/
  17.             else if (txtgettitle.Text.Contains("twitch"))
  18.             {
  19.                  script = string.Format("document.getElementsByClassName('player-button player-button--volume qa-control-volume')[0].click();");
  20.                 browser.EvaluateScriptAsync(script);
  21.                 Console.WriteLine("音量ON/OFF変更を試みました");
  22.             }
  23.             if (txtgettitle.Text.Contains("on"))
  24.             {
  25.                 //  adjFontloc_noteon();
  26.             }
  27.             /* else{
  28.                  //adjFontloc_noteoff();
  29.              }*/
  30.             else if (txtgettitle.Text.Contains("youtube"))
  31.             {
  32.                 script = string.Format("document.getElementsByClassName('ytp-mute-button ytp-button')[0].click();");
  33.                 browser.EvaluateScriptAsync(script);
  34.                 Console.WriteLine("音量ON/OFF変更を試みました");
  35.             }
  36.             if (txtgettitle.Text.Contains("on"))
  37.             {
  38.                 //  adjFontloc_noteon();
  39.             }
  40.             /* else{
  41.                  //adjFontloc_noteoff();
  42.              }*/
  43.  
  44.             else if (txtgettitle.Text.Contains("mixer"))
  45.             {
  46.                 script = string.Format("document.getElementsByClassName('_ngcontent-c32')[0].click();");
  47.                 browser.EvaluateScriptAsync(script);
  48.                 Console.WriteLine("音量ON/OFF変更を試みました");
  49.             }
  50.             if (txtgettitle.Text.Contains("on"))
  51.             {
  52.                 //  adjFontloc_noteon();
  53.             }
  54.             /* else{
  55.                  //adjFontloc_noteoff();
  56.              }*/
  57.  
  58.         }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ement